《数据库系统概论》课程设计实验报告书-高校科研管理系统设计

《数据库系统概论》课程设计实验报告书-高校科研管理系统设计

ID:18685009

大小:1.07 MB

页数:33页

时间:2018-09-21

《数据库系统概论》课程设计实验报告书-高校科研管理系统设计_第1页
《数据库系统概论》课程设计实验报告书-高校科研管理系统设计_第2页
《数据库系统概论》课程设计实验报告书-高校科研管理系统设计_第3页
《数据库系统概论》课程设计实验报告书-高校科研管理系统设计_第4页
《数据库系统概论》课程设计实验报告书-高校科研管理系统设计_第5页
资源描述:

《《数据库系统概论》课程设计实验报告书-高校科研管理系统设计》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、《数据库系统概论》课程设计实验报告书安徽工业大学计算机学院姓名XXX专业软件工程班级092班学号XXX指导教师申元霞分数2011年12月5日《数据库系统概论》课程设计实验报告书安徽工业大学计算机学院摘要高校科研是高校面临的一项重要任务,科研管理内容也比较复杂,科研涉及的内容极广泛、面临项目、资金和人员的管理。我国高校科研主要是以文字档案的形式来对其信息进行管理。这种人工的管理方式不仅效率低下、出错率高,并且保密措施也不够严格。往往随着时间的推移、信息量的增大,使得其在进行分类添加或修改的时候难度不

2、断增大,极大的阻碍了科研信息的更新和科研进程的发展。另外如果出现档案保管不妥导致丢失等问题,其对整个科研进程的危害将是毁灭性的。因此制作一个通用的高校科研管理系统是十分重要的和必要的。本课程设计采用的是C#制作一个科研管理系统。在本案例的制作中,涉及到菜单的制作方法以及菜单在新的主界面中(不是由向导生成的主对话框)的过程代码的编制方法,还涉及到系统多文档界面的制作。关键字:科研管理系统、科研信息管理、数据库操作、可视化编程。《数据库系统概论》课程设计实验报告书安徽工业大学计算机学院目录1绪论21.

3、1概述21.1.1问题的提出21.1.2本课题的意义21.2开发环境与工具介绍21.2.1ADO.NET简介22系统需求分析与设计32.1用户需求分析32.1.1用户需求32.1.2系统功能需求32.1.3系统性能需求32.1.4数据分析42.2功能模块图及分模块功能描述52.2.1系统的功能模块图52.2.2系统功能模块简介52.3数据库设计52.3.1系统E-R图52.3.2数据库逻辑结构设计93系统实施103.1建立数据库103.2数据库连接113.3主要模块实施123.3.1登录模块的开发

4、123.3.2注册模块的开发133.3.3主系统模块的开发143.3.4密码修改模块的开发153.3.5职称信息管理模块的开发163.3.6科研信息管理模块的开发173.3.7开发模块总览183.4系统测试203.4.1软件测试的对象203.4.2软件测试的结果214系统说明224.1开发环境224.2系统安装、配置与发布应用程序的步骤22总结23参考文献24附录:部分源代码251.《数据库系统概论》课程设计实验报告书安徽工业大学计算机学院1绪论1.1概述1.1.1问题的提出随着科研信息的数据量越

5、来越大,人工操作越来越困难,需要对其定做科研管理系统。其目的是为了方便维护和方便操作管理科研信息。1.1.2本课题的意义1.掌握数据库设计的基本方法,熟悉数据库设计的步骤;2.通过设计数据库系统应用课题,进一步熟悉数据库管理系统的操作技术,提高动手能力,提高分析问题和解决问题的能力;3.学习基本数据库编程方法。1.2开发环境与工具介绍开发环境:MicrosoftVisualStudio2010和MicrosoftSQLServer20051、开发环境MicrosoftVisualStudio201

6、0简介:VisualStudio是微软公司推出的开发环境。是目前最流行的Windows平台应用程序开发环境。VisualStudio2010版本于2010年4月12日上市,其集成开发环境(IDE)的界面被重新设计和组织,变得更加简单明了。VisualStudio2010同时带来了NETFramework4.0、MicrosoftVisualStudio2010CTP(CommunityTechnologyPreview--CTP),并且支持开发面向Windows7的应用程序。除了Microsoft

7、SQLServer,它还支持IBMDB2和Oracle数据库。MicrosoftVisualStudio2010采用拖曳式便能完成软件的开发。简简单单的操作便可以实现一个界面的生成。但拖曳的界面,也应当有相应的代码来实现功能。MicrosoftVisualStudio2010支持C#、C++、VB。可以快速实现相应的功能。2、数据库MicrosoftSQLServer2005简介:SQLServer是一个关系数据库管理系统。它最初是由MicrosoftSybase和Ashton-Tate三家公司共

8、同开发的,于1988年推出了第一个OS/2版本。SQLServer2005的几个主要特性增强,重点关注企业数据管理、开发人员生产力和商务智能。1.2.1ADO.NET简介ADO.NET的名称起源于ADO(ActiveXDataObjects),这是一个广泛的类组,用于在以往的Microsoft技术中访问数据.之所以使用ADO.NET名称,是因为Microsoft希望表明,这是在.NET编程环境中优先使用的数据访问接口.它提供了平台互用性和可伸缩的数据访问。ADO.NET增强了对非连

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。